Retro gaming has seen a resurgence in recent years, with classic consoles like the NES and Sega Genesis being re-released and old-school games becoming popular again. Many gamers are drawn to the nostalgia and simplicity of these early video games, while others appreciate the challenge and timeless design. With the rise of streaming platforms and indie developers creating games with retro aesthetics, it's clear that the classics never really go out of style.
